Definition & Meaning of Hampton Inn Credit Card Authorization Form
A Hampton Inn credit card authorization form is a crucial document that allows a third party, such as a company or individual, to authorize charges to their credit card for a guest's stay at the hotel. This form is particularly useful when the cardholder is not present during the check-in process. It ensures that the hotel can secure payment for the room, taxes, and any incidental charges that may arise during the stay. By completing this form, the cardholder grants permission for the hotel to charge their credit card, which is essential for business travelers or group bookings.
The form typically includes essential information such as the cardholder's name, credit card details, guest information, and the specific charges that are approved. It also requires the cardholder's signature, which serves as a legal authorization for the charges. In many cases, a copy of the credit card and a photo ID may be required to verify the identity of the cardholder, adding an extra layer of security to the transaction.
How to Use the Hampton Inn Credit Card Authorization Form
Using the Hampton Inn credit card authorization form involves several straightforward steps that ensure the process is smooth and secure. To begin, the cardholder must obtain the form, which can typically be downloaded from the hotel's website or requested directly from the hotel. Once in possession of the form, the cardholder should fill in their details, including their name, credit card type, number, expiration date, and billing address.
Next, the form requires the guest's information, such as their name, arrival date, and confirmation number. It is vital to specify what charges the card will cover. This could range from room and tax only to all incidentals, including parking and room service. After completing the form, the cardholder must sign it, confirming their authorization for the charges. It is also advisable to attach a copy of the front and back of the credit card along with a photo ID for verification purposes.

Key Elements of the Hampton Inn Credit Card Authorization Form
Understanding the key elements of the Hampton Inn credit card authorization form is vital for its proper completion. The form typically includes the following components:
- Cardholder Details: This section requires the cardholder's name, credit card type (such as Visa or MasterCard), card number, expiration date, billing address, and contact number.
- Guest Information: Here, the name of the guest staying at the hotel, their arrival date, and the reservation confirmation number must be provided.
- Authorization Details: This part specifies what the card will be charged for, such as room and tax, incidentals, or other services.
- Signature: The cardholder must sign the form to authorize the charges, confirming their consent.
- Attachments: Typically, a copy of the front and back of the credit card and a government-issued photo ID are required for verification purposes.

Legal Use of the Hampton Inn Credit Card Authorization Form
The legal use of the Hampton Inn credit card authorization form is essential for both the cardholder and the hotel. By signing the form, the cardholder grants explicit permission for the hotel to charge their credit card, which serves as a binding agreement. This legal authorization protects the hotel from potential disputes regarding payment and ensures that the cardholder is aware of the charges being incurred.
It is important for the cardholder to understand that by submitting the form, they are responsible for any charges made under their authorization. This includes any additional costs that may arise during the guest's stay, such as room service or damages. Therefore, careful consideration should be given to the details included in the authorization form.
